Avoid bad method call to patchPatch() in DbTestRecorder
authorAaron Schulz <aschulz@wikimedia.org>
Mon, 25 Jun 2018 20:14:08 +0000 (21:14 +0100)
committerAaron Schulz <aschulz@wikimedia.org>
Mon, 25 Jun 2018 20:14:13 +0000 (21:14 +0100)
Bug: T193995
Change-Id: Ibc480b04463792b7cd720a6eb080e0960a30e440

tests/parser/DbTestRecorder.php

index f68f595..2089f64 100644 (file)
@@ -41,7 +41,8 @@ class DbTestRecorder extends TestRecorder {
                        || !$this->db->tableExists( 'testitem' )
                ) {
                        print "WARNING> `testrun` table not found in database. Trying to create table.\n";
-                       $this->db->sourceFile( $this->db->patchPath( 'patch-testrun.sql' ) );
+                       $updater = DatabaseUpdater::newForDB( $this->db );
+                       $this->db->sourceFile( $updater->patchPath( $this->db, 'patch-testrun.sql' ) );
                        echo "OK, resuming.\n";
                }